Flavor Profile of the Filling

The filling in Spinach and Artichoke Stuffed Chicken is a harmonious blend of flavors and textures. Cream cheese, mozzarella, and Parmesan create a rich, cheesy consistency that perfectly complements the sautéed spinach and artichoke hearts.

This mixture is seasoned with garlic and Italian spices, adding depth and warmth to each bite. The combination of these ingredients ensures a satisfying experience, transforming a simple chicken breast into a delightful culinary creation.

Cooking Techniques for Success

To achieve the ideal texture and flavor, a few key techniques are vital when preparing Spinach and Artichoke Stuffed Chicken. The process begins with carefully creating pockets in the chicken breasts, ensuring they are deep enough to hold the filling without compromising the integrity of the meat.

Cooking the spinach and artichokes before mixing them with cheese helps in achieving a well-blended filling. Sautéing the garlic adds an aromatic element that enhances the overall taste. Finally, baking the chicken in a preheated oven ensures that it cooks evenly and remains juicy.

Delicious Spinach and Artichoke Stuffed Chicken Recipe

 

This Spinach and Artichoke Stuffed Chicken is a mouthwatering dish featuring tender chicken breasts filled with a rich mixture of sautéed spinach, artichokes, cream cheese, and mozzarella. The chicken is then baked to perfection, resulting in juicy, flavorful meat paired with a creamy filling that bursts with taste.

Ingredients

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
  • 1 cup artichoke hearts, chopped (canned or frozen)
  • 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Instructions

  1. Prep the Chicken: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Carefully slice a pocket into each chicken breast, making sure not to cut all the way through.
  2. Make the Filling: In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add garlic and sauté until fragrant. Then stir in chopped spinach and artichoke hearts, cooking until the spinach wilts. Remove from heat and mix in cream cheese, mozzarella, and Parmesan until well combined. Season with garlic powder, onion powder, sal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ning.
  3. Stuff the Chicken: Generously fill each chicken breast pocket with the spinach and artichoke mixture, securing with toothpicks if necessary.
  4. Bake: Place the stuffed chicken breasts in a greased baking dish. Drizzle with a little olive oil and season with additional salt and pepper. Bake for about 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ink in the center.
  5. Serve: Allow the chicken to rest for a few minutes before slicing. Serve warm, perhaps with a side of rice or a fresh salad.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Nutrition Information

  • Servings: 4
  • Calories: 320kcal
  • Fat: 18g
  • Protein: 30g
  • Carbohydrates: 6g
